Guys Being Dads is a podcast about fatherhood, life, and everything that comes with it — told through real conversations, not expert advice. Some weeks it’s just two regular dudes riffing on parenting, marriage, work, friendships, and whatever season of life they’re in. Other weeks, we’ll bring on other dads to share stories, perspectives, and lessons learned along the way. No scripts. No hot takes. No parenting playbook.
